WHSmith Travel to Implement RELEX’s Supply Chain Optimization Technology for its Fresh and Chilled Foods

Mar 1, 2017 3 min

WHSmith Travel aims to increase availability and better manage waste through improved stock forecasting and replenishment with RELEX Solutions.

WHSmith Travel has selected RELEX Solutions, one of the fastest growing providers of integrated retail and supply chain planning solutions, to improve demand forecasting and replenishment in order to increase availability and reduce wastage of its fresh and chilled foods.

WHSmith

The travel business of the WHSmith Group comprises around 750 stores predominantly at UK airports and railway stations. The fastest growing part of the Group, WHSmith Travel sought a technology solution that would help it make intelligent and informed supply chain business decisions to optimize its operational efficiency, reduce costs and wastage, and improve customer satisfaction for its short shelf-life products, including sandwiches, prepared salads, chilled food-to-go, and convenience range.

WHSmith selected RELEX following a comprehensive evaluation of technology solutions available, during which the technology provider came out on top due to its proven capabilities in fresh food, rapid implementation timescales, and strong customer references.

In addition to improved decision-making around forecasting and automated replenishment, with RELEX, WHSmith will also gain the ability to analyze historical passenger numbers and footfall, and use machine learning to conduct a regression analysis to predict future customer visits.

“Our travel arm is the most rapidly expanding part of our business. As such there is a great need for us to enhance our decision making around forecasting and replenishment, in order to make our supply chain operate as optimally as possible,” said Ian Windsor, CIO at WHSmith. “Our main objectives are to reduce and better manage waste, and get the right products available at the right time, in the right quantity. We want our customers to be able to select the products they want and we need to make sure our food cabinets have optimized stock levels, so we do not lose out on sales.”

Windsor added, “RELEX Solutions is at the forefront of fresh food supply chain technology and with its capabilities, system flexibility and speed of delivery, we are confident that we will start to see quick results.”

“We are looking forward to working in close collaboration with WHSmith and having the opportunity to help it meet its strategic objectives, gain valuable customer insight and support the continued growth of the business,” said Paul Cowley, Sales Director of RELEX Solutions.

WHSmith is due to go live on the new system during Spring 2017.

About WHSmith

With more than 600 stores in city centers and more than 700 outlets at airports, train stations, hospitals and motorway services, WH Smith is a leading retailer of News, Books and Convenience items. The company has a growing international presence being in more than 50 airports worldwide including London Heathrow, Copenhagen, Stockholm, Doha, Abu Dhabi, Delhi, Shanghai, Sydney and Melbourne. The company employs about 14,000 people.
